Lions Stadium (also known as Luxury Paints Stadium for sponsorship reasons)[1] is a soccer stadium located in Brisbane, Queensland, Australia. It has lights for night matches and can seat up to 5000 people.[2]
It serves as the primary ground for the Queensland Lions in the National Premier League.[3]
It also hosts the Brisbane Roar Women and the Brisbane Roar Academy teams.[4][5]
